According to a recent report by Expert Market Research (EMR), the global green ammonia market is expected to witness robust growth, with a projected CAGR of 58.3% between 2024 and 2032. The growing emphasis on sustainable and green energy solutions and the rising need for decarbonization across multiple industries are propelling the demand for green ammonia worldwide.
Green ammonia, produced through renewable energy sources such as wind, solar, and hydroelectric power, offers an environmentally friendly alternative to traditional ammonia produced using fossil fuels. The rising awareness of carbon emissions and the need to meet climate goals, such as the Paris Agreement, has encouraged industries to explore green alternatives, further boosting the market growth.
The primary driver behind the increasing demand for green ammonia is its potential application in the fertilizer industry, maritime fuel, and energy storage sectors. The fertilizer industry accounts for a significant share of ammonia consumption, and the shift towards green ammonia is expected to reduce the carbon footprint of this essential agricultural input.
Furthermore, green ammonia is emerging as a clean energy carrier and is gaining traction in hydrogen transportation and energy storage. With countries and corporations focusing on reducing carbon emissions, green ammonia is seen as a promising energy vector for carbon-neutral fuels, particularly for long-distance shipping and heavy industries, which are otherwise difficult to decarbonize.
Additionally, technological advancements in electrolysis and hydrogen production, coupled with significant investments in renewable energy projects, are expected to aid the expansion of the global green ammonia market. Several pilot projects are already underway in key regions, setting the stage for mass commercialization by 2032.

Market Segmentation
The green ammonia market can be segmented based on production technology, application, and region.
Market Breakup by Production Technology
- Electrolysis: This method involves the splitting of water into hydrogen and oxygen using renewable electricity, followed by the synthesis of ammonia.
- Solid Oxide Electrolysis: A more advanced method using solid oxide cells to efficiently produce hydrogen and oxygen.
- Proton Exchange Membrane (PEM): A newer method focused on using hydrogen fuel cells to synthesize ammonia directly.
Market Breakup by Application
- Fertilizers: Green ammonia is a key ingredient in nitrogen-based fertilizers, and the growing demand for sustainable agricultural inputs is driving the sector.
- Energy Storage: Green ammonia’s ability to store energy in a carbon-neutral manner has created significant demand in renewable energy storage applications.
- Maritime Fuels: Green ammonia is gaining attention as a clean fuel alternative for the shipping industry, which is under pressure to reduce carbon emissions.
- Hydrogen Carrier: Due to its high hydrogen density, ammonia is being considered for transportation and storage of hydrogen.
Market Breakup by Region
- North America: The U.S. and Canada are investing heavily in renewable energy and are pioneers in pilot projects for green ammonia production.
- Europe: Europe, led by countries like Germany and the Netherlands, is a significant player in the green ammonia market, driven by stringent climate regulations and high renewable energy capacity.
- Asia Pacific: Countries like Japan, South Korea, and Australia are making strategic investments in green ammonia production, largely driven by the need for energy security and decarbonization.
- Latin America: Brazil and Chile are exploring the green ammonia market to support their renewable energy growth.
- Middle East and Africa: Although the region is traditionally dominated by fossil fuels, countries like Saudi Arabia and the UAE are exploring green ammonia as part of their renewable energy strategies.
